βSponsoring cultural institutions is a well-documented tobacco industry tactic. Among public health practitioners and researchers, itβs widely seen as part of the industryβs efforts to improve its public image and achieve policy influence.β
The British Museum has ended its 15-year partnership with Japan Tobacco International #JTI.
Dr Allen Gallagher, Dr Duncan Thomas and Dr Sophie Braznell write for @uk.theconversation.com on what this means for tobacco industry sponsorship of the arts.

Faculty of Public Health supports new Polluter Pays Levy Scheme for tobacco companies
The Faculty of Public Health has published a new position statement in supportΒ of a βpolluter paysβ levy scheme for tobacco products in the UK.
NEW π : FPH supports a βpolluter paysβ levy scheme for tobacco products in the UK.
This would cap wholesale tobacco prices whilst increasing tax on tobacco or applying a new health levy, limiting industry profits & generating revenue to achieve a smokefree future.

βThe long term effects of e-cigarette use are still uncertain, but harms established in children and young people today will have future consequences. The failure to protect childrenβs right to health today could result in harms which span generations.β
A recent analysis in the @bmj.com by Tom Gatehouse, Professor Emily Banks, @brigittoebes.bsky.social sky.social and Dr Raouf Alebshehy, argues that e-cigarette regulation must prioritise the rights of children.

The 4th Meeting of the Parties to the Protocol to Eliminate Illicit Trade in Tobacco Products #MOP4 has begun today.
At this meeting, Parties to the Protocol will discuss strategies to counter the illicit trade in tobacco products including the smuggling and counterfeiting of cigarettes.
